“HARRIET TUBMAN: VISIONS OF FREEDOM”
This year marks the 200th anniversary of Harriet Tubman’s birth. In honor of her legacy, PBS presents a documentary “Harriet Tubman: Visions of Freedom,” a portrait of the woman known as a conductor of the Underground Railroad. Nicole London, the film’s co-director and producer, joins us to explore what motivated Tubman to become one of the greatest freedom fighters in our nation's history.
